About the event
Join Links with Nature and Captain Raggy Beard for some spooky story telling and nature-based crafts. These sessions are recommended for ages 5+ (younger children may attend, parent/guardians will need to support with craft creation).
Activities
- Story telling with Captain Raggy Beard.
- Autumn and Halloween themed Nature-based Crafts by Links with Nature including Spider Web Dream Catchers, Conker or Pinecone Spider or decorate willow woven Witches Wands.
